Adding upstream version 1.9.1+dfsg.
Signed-off-by: Daniel Baumann <daniel@debian.org>
This commit is contained in:
parent
c6123b914a
commit
dafef1aa3b
1847 changed files with 36221 additions and 0 deletions
24
build/font/css.hbs
Normal file
24
build/font/css.hbs
Normal file
|
@ -0,0 +1,24 @@
|
|||
@font-face {
|
||||
font-display: block;
|
||||
font-family: "{{ name }}";
|
||||
src: {{{ fontSrc }}};
|
||||
}
|
||||
|
||||
.{{prefix}}::before,
|
||||
[class^="{{prefix}}-"]::before,
|
||||
[class*=" {{prefix}}-"]::before {
|
||||
display: inline-block;
|
||||
font-family: {{ name }} !important;
|
||||
font-style: normal;
|
||||
font-weight: normal !important;
|
||||
font-variant: normal;
|
||||
text-transform: none;
|
||||
line-height: 1;
|
||||
vertical-align: -.125em;
|
||||
-webkit-font-smoothing: antialiased;
|
||||
-moz-osx-font-smoothing: grayscale;
|
||||
}
|
||||
|
||||
{{# each codepoints }}
|
||||
.{{ ../prefix }}-{{ @key }}::before { content: "\\{{ codepoint this }}"; }
|
||||
{{/ each }}
|
53
build/font/html.hbs
Normal file
53
build/font/html.hbs
Normal file
|
@ -0,0 +1,53 @@
|
|||
<!doctype html>
|
||||
<html lang="en">
|
||||
<head>
|
||||
<meta charset="utf-8">
|
||||
<title>{{ name }}</title>
|
||||
|
||||
<style>
|
||||
.icons {
|
||||
display: grid;
|
||||
max-width: 100%;
|
||||
grid-template-columns: repeat(auto-fit, minmax(100px, 1fr) );
|
||||
gap: 1.25rem;
|
||||
}
|
||||
.icon {
|
||||
background-color: var(--bs-light);
|
||||
border-radius: .25rem;
|
||||
}
|
||||
.bi {
|
||||
margin: .25rem;
|
||||
font-size: 2.5rem;
|
||||
}
|
||||
.label {
|
||||
font-family: var(--bs-font-monospace);
|
||||
}
|
||||
.label {
|
||||
display: inline-block;
|
||||
width: 100%;
|
||||
overflow: hidden;
|
||||
padding: .25rem;
|
||||
font-size: .625rem;
|
||||
text-overflow: ellipsis;
|
||||
white-space: nowrap;
|
||||
}
|
||||
</style>
|
||||
|
||||
<link rel="stylesheet" href="/assets/css/bootstrap.min.css">
|
||||
<link rel="stylesheet" href="{{ name }}.css">
|
||||
</head>
|
||||
<body class="text-center">
|
||||
|
||||
<h1>{{ name }}</h1>
|
||||
|
||||
<div class="icons">
|
||||
{{# each assets }}
|
||||
<div class="icon">
|
||||
<{{ ../tag }} class="{{ ../prefix }} {{ ../prefix }}-{{ @key }}"></{{ ../tag }}>
|
||||
<div class="label">{{ @key }}</div>
|
||||
</div>
|
||||
{{/ each }}
|
||||
</div>
|
||||
|
||||
</body>
|
||||
</html>
|
36
build/font/scss.hbs
Normal file
36
build/font/scss.hbs
Normal file
|
@ -0,0 +1,36 @@
|
|||
${{ name }}-font: "{{ name }}" !default;
|
||||
${{ name }}-font-dir: "{{ fontsUrl }}" !default;
|
||||
${{ name }}-font-file: #{${{ name }}-font-dir}/#{${{ name }}-font} !default;
|
||||
${{ name }}-font-hash: "8d200481aa7f02a2d63a331fc782cfaf" !default;
|
||||
${{ name }}-font-src: url("#{${{ name }}-font-file}.woff2?#{${{ name }}-font-hash}") format("woff2"), url("#{${{ name }}-font-file}.woff?#{${{ name }}-font-hash}") format("woff") !default;
|
||||
|
||||
@font-face {
|
||||
font-display: block;
|
||||
font-family: ${{ name }}-font;
|
||||
src: ${{ name }}-font-src;
|
||||
}
|
||||
|
||||
.{{prefix}}::before,
|
||||
[class^="{{prefix}}-"]::before,
|
||||
[class*=" {{prefix}}-"]::before {
|
||||
display: inline-block;
|
||||
font-family: ${{ name }}-font !important;
|
||||
font-style: normal;
|
||||
font-weight: normal !important;
|
||||
font-variant: normal;
|
||||
text-transform: none;
|
||||
line-height: 1;
|
||||
vertical-align: -.125em;
|
||||
-webkit-font-smoothing: antialiased;
|
||||
-moz-osx-font-smoothing: grayscale;
|
||||
}
|
||||
|
||||
${{ name }}-map: (
|
||||
{{# each codepoints }}
|
||||
"{{ @key }}": "\\{{ codepoint this }}",
|
||||
{{/ each }}
|
||||
);
|
||||
|
||||
{{# each codepoints }}
|
||||
.{{ ../prefix }}-{{ @key }}::before { content: map-get(${{ ../name }}-map, "{{ @key }}"); }
|
||||
{{/ each }}
|
Loading…
Add table
Add a link
Reference in a new issue